The story follows Doug MacRay (Affleck), the leader of a ruthless crew of bank robbers. During a job, his volatile partner James "Jem" Coughlin (Jeremy Renner) takes a hostage, Claire Keesey. After she is released, Doug tracks her down to see what she knows, but an unexpected romance blossoms. The_Town_2010_HD_-_Altadefinizione01

The movie The Town (2010) , directed by and starring Ben Affleck, remains a definitive masterpiece of the modern heist genre. Set in the gritty streets of Charlestown, Boston, the film balances high-octane action with a deeply personal story about cycles of crime and the hope for redemption.
